Pressure Switch NSN 5930-01-027-9514

Item Description

A switch which is actuated by changes in pressure of any gas or liquid or by changes in a vacuum acting upon its sensing element. Excludes baroswitch; switch, pressure-thermostatic; and switch, sensitive.
